Gestalt Therapy Part One
The central concern of Gestalt Therapy is awareness. That is, a live and immediate grasp of our present situation, in context, that provides a coherent, holistic understanding of our situation and our own/others’ needs.

According to Gestalt Therapy theory, a lack of awareness leads to suffering: diminishment, rigidity, impulsivity, chaos, numbness. Increased awareness leads to self-confidence, competence, connection, spontaneity, creativity, satisfaction, and a smoother flow of life.
In Gestalt, “Awareness” is not about “common sense,” nor is it a privileging of the therapist’s awareness above that of the client. Instead, the Gestalt therapist engages the client in a co-exploration of phenomenological processes that includes dialogue, experimentation, and an authentic relationship between two fellow human beings.
Through a combination of lecture, discussion, experiential exercises, and experiential practice, this course introduces participants to the most fundamental building blocks of gestalt therapy: Contact, awareness, figure/ground, the here & now.
